   Need help choosing a Wireless VPN router

   Here's the deal... I'm looking for a low cost wireless router that can   
   handle site to site VPN and VPN for remote users.  One site (primary)   
   has 10 users, the other has 5 then 4 people that will need to be able to   
   connect to the resources on the primary site.  Both sites have static IPs.   
      
   Right now, the they are Netscreen 5XP for the site to site.  But so far,   
   it doesn't work as it's suppose to and the sites lose their VPN   
   connection a few times a day.  No one, remote users or the 2ns site can   
   browse the network and when transfering large files people lose their   
   VPN connection.  BTW, when the VPN connection is lost, it shows it's   
   still connected on the system tray but when you pull the client software   
   up, it shows it's not connected.  This causes remote users to have to   
   reboot their system to reconnect.   
      
   Now, I'm looking at this new Linksys WRV54G, but I've been seeing posts   
   where it doesn't have some features they had with their previous end   
   points and some features just don't work.  I also looked saw that Dlink   
   have a VPN box, but I can't get any info from them and the Sonicwall TZW   
   seems like the best best, but I don't want to spend over a grand to find   
   it doesn't work.   
      
   I've got a DSL connection here at home and also a friend who has a cable   
   connection at his home for use to run tests on whatever I figure out   
   will work b4 I present this new option to the company.  Anyone got a   
   suggestion where I can get 2 VPN boxes for site to site for me to test   
   with where the total cost will be under $500 smackers?
